Codemasters is on a roll, yesterday they sent Cannon Fodder to PSP and today they announced T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ge, a new game in the motorsport series, coming to PSP in the winter of 2006.

TOCA Race Driver 2 (PSP)Set to launch exclusively in PAL territories, T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ge is being designed from the ground up for PSP gaming with an emphasis on burst play and will deliver all the motorsport excitement the series is known for.

T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ge will roar in with a cavalcade of officially licensed racecars, world-famous tracks and a new, progressive central game mode – the World Challenge. As the piston-pumping heart of the game, the World Challenge will see players competing through a series of international championship tiers, each packed with skill tests, specialised events and championships that span different racing styles.

In addition to the World Challenge, T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ge will come loaded with additional play modes including: Free Race and Time Trial. There’s also wireless WLAN multiplayer action play for up to a staggering 12 players simultaneously and further multiplayer action via Game Share, enabling up to four players to enjoy fantastic WLAN racing from just one UMD.

Each World Challenge tier is designed to enhance and expand your race driving skills and experience. First, a series of tests and events will build your racing prowess in areas such as damage control, using the racing line, manoeuvring, timely pit stops and braking accuracy. Now you’re ready for the main event: the tier’s specialist Championship season with a series of closely-fought multiple car races on different circuits. Come first overall in the championship and you’ll move up to compete in the next tier of the World Challenge.

Throughout T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ge, you’ll be racing the world as each tier has its own international location and theme: from the British GP, to the heavyweight touring cars of Australia’s V8 Supercars and Germany’s DTM events, through to American Race series across the USA and then to a global Masters championship tier where you’ll compete against the best of the best.

Of course, with all this competitive racing, T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ge features spectacular collisions thanks to its realistic damage system: sparks fly when you bottom out, smoke billows from tyres, doors flap, windscreens shatter, wings get ripped off, spoilers break and fly from the car and bodywork realistically deforms with every impact.

TOCA Race Driver 3 Challenge is the evolution of the series on PSP and successor to the PSP game TOCA Race Driver 2 (September 2005), rather than a handheld adaptation of TOCA Race Driver 3 on PlayStation 2 (February 2006).
